Reporting the Incident

The first step after experiencing an assault during an Uber ride is to report the incident promptly. Contacting local law enforcement authorities is essential, as they have the expertise and resources to investigate the matter thoroughly. Provide them with all the relevant details, including the date, time, location, driver's name, and any other information that can help in identifying the perpetrator.

In addition to reporting to the police, it is vital to inform Uber about the incident. Uber takes passenger safety seriously and has protocols in place to handle such situations. Open the Uber app, navigate to the "Safety Toolkit," and select the appropriate option to report the incident. Uber will investigate the matter and take necessary actions against the driver, including removing them from the platform.

Seeking Support in the Community

Communities play a crucial role in supporting survivors of assault. Many organizations and helplines are dedicated to providing assistance and guidance in such situations. Here are a few resources you can turn to for support in your community:

  1. Local Police Department: Reach out to your local police department's non-emergency line or visit their office to file a report. They can offer guidance, connect you with victim advocates, and provide information about available resources.
  2. Crisis Hotlines: Various crisis hotlines are available for survivors of assault, offering 24/7 support and guidance. RAINN (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network) operates a confidential helpline (1-800-656-HOPE) that can connect you with local resources and counseling services.
  3. Counseling Services: Seeking professional counseling is essential for survivors of assault to cope with trauma and initiate the healing process. Organizations like the National Sexual Assault Hotline (800-656-HOPE) can assist in locating local counseling services.
  4. Support Groups: Joining support groups with individuals who have gone through similar experiences can be immensely helpful. Sharing stories, exchanging advice, and finding solace in a community that understands can aid in the healing journey. Organizations like RAINN can provide information on local support groups.
